GLOBE POST (GP) is an independent community newspaper established in March 1992 printing 20 000 copies monthly. GLOBE POST is distributed door to door, free of charge in Lenasia South, Ennerdale, Finetown, Hospital Hills, Migson Manor, Lawley, Phumlamqashi and surrounds by experienced in-house teams who are closely monitored to ensure maximum readership and footprint.  GLOBE POST has an estimated monthly readership of 80 000 with an LSM of 3 – 10.
